Russell Middle is a Title I public middle school that is part of the Brunswick County Public Schools school district, located in Lawrenceville, VA with about 364 students offering grade levels from 6th Grade to 8th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 33 teachers, James S. Russell Middle has a student/teacher ratio of about 11: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.
James S. Russell Middle School is located in Lawrenceville, Virginia, and serves as a key educational institution within the Brunswick County Public Schools district. The school is named in honor of Archdeacon James Solomon Russell, a prominent historical figure in the region and the founder of Saint Paul's College.
